Hanukkah for Kids

What is Hanukkah? Hanukkah is the eight day Jewish holiday known as the “festival of lights” or “feast of dedication.”  Each year the holiday falls sometime between late November and the end of December.  In 2011, Hanukkah will last from December 20th to the 28th. Hanukkah…
